CRE-mediated gene transcription in neocortical neuronal plasticity during the developmental critical period.

摘要

Neuronal activity-dependent processes are believed to mediate the formation of synaptic connections during neocortical development, but the underlying intracellular mechanisms are not known. In the visual system, altering the pattern of visually driven neuronal activity by monocular deprivation induces cortical synaptic rearrangement during a postnatal developmental window, the critical period. Here, using transgenic mice carrying a CRE-lacZ reporter, we demonstrate that a calcium- and cAMP-regulated signaling pathway is activated following monocular deprivation. We find that monocular deprivation leads to an induction of CRE-mediated lacZ expression in the visual cortex preceding the onset of physiologic plasticity, and this induction is dramatically downregulated following the end of the critical period. These results suggest that CRE-dependent coordinate regulation of a network of genes may control physiologic plasticity during postnatal neocortical development.
机译:据信神经元活动依赖性过程介导新皮层发育过程中突触连接的形成,但潜在的细胞内机制尚不清楚。在视觉系统中,通过单眼剥夺改变视觉驱动的神经元活动的模式会在出生后的发育期(关键时期)引起皮质突触重排。在这里,使用携带CRE-lacZ报告基因的转基因小鼠,我们证明了单眼剥夺后激活了钙和cAMP调节的信号通路。我们发现单眼剥夺导致生理可塑性发作之前视觉皮层中CRE介导的lacZ表达的诱导,并且在关键时期结束后,这种诱导显着下调。这些结果表明,基因网络的CRE依赖性协调调控可能在出生后新皮层发育过程中控制生理可塑性。
